为什么windows udp接收套接字的超时总是比SO_RCVTIMEO设置的时间长500毫秒?

问题描述 投票:2回答:1

易于重现,这是我正在做的伪代码:

  1. 设置UDP套接字
  2. 将超时设置为值(Timeout set
  3. 检查我设置的超时(Timeout checked
  4. 尝试在该套接字上接收(当没有流量时)。
  5. 超时需要多长时间。 (Time until Timeout

当我这样做时,我得到以下输出:

Timeout set: 0.1s | Timeout checked: 0.1s | Time until timeout: 0.6s | difference: 0.5s
Timeout set: 0.2s | Timeout checked: 0.2s | Time until timeout: 0.7s | difference: 0.5s
Timeout set: 0.4s | Timeout checked: 0.4s | Time until timeout: 0.9s | difference: 0.5s
Timeout set: 0.8s | Timeout checked: 0.8s | Time until timeout: 1.3s | difference: 0.5s
Timeout set: 1.6s | Timeout checked: 1.6s | Time until timeout: 2.1s | difference: 0.5s
Timeout set: 3.2s | Timeout checked: 3.2s | Time until timeout: 3.7s | difference: 0.5s

为什么windows udp套接字超时总是比setsockopt中设置的时间长500ms?

看看setsockopt here我看不到有关为什么在涉及SO_RCVTIMEO的部分发生这种情况的信息。

据说是here:

SO_RCVTIMEO上的无证件最低限制约为500mS。

这可能是通过始终为SO_RCVTIMEO设置的任何值添加500毫秒来实现的。
